Documenting Night Sky Brightness Using Sky Quality Meters, Ryan Sergent, Jennifer Birriel Apr 2021

Documenting Night Sky Brightness Using Sky Quality Meters, Ryan Sergent, Jennifer Birriel

2021 Celebration of Student Scholarship - Oral Presentations

The use of artificial light at night contributes to light pollution across the globe. Prior to 2005, artificial sources of light at night were mainly high- and low-pressure sodium light sources, which are yellow rich. The increased use of LED lighting is changing spectral signature of the night sky is changing. LEDs emit a peak in blue light. Blue light is scattered much more effectively than yellow and red, increased use of LEDs will increase both glare and skyglow. An Overview Of The Qualified Immunity Doctrine And Its Application In Kentucky Law, Ethan Garvin, Joe Dunman Apr 2021

An Overview Of The Qualified Immunity Doctrine And Its Application In Kentucky Law, Ethan Garvin, Joe Dunman

2021 Celebration of Student Scholarship - Oral Presentations

Qualified immunity is a legal doctrine that protects law enforcement officers from lawsuits if the courts find their actions fit three criteria: the action must be discretionary rather than ministerial, the action must be in good faith, and the action must be within the scope of the employee’s authority. By conducting a survey of cases in both the Kentucky court system and the federal court system, this presentation analyzes how qualified immunity is applied. Photocatalytic Inactivation Efficacy Of Sars-Cov-2 In Hvac Systems, Andrew J. Freeman, Sudharshan Anandan, Ernest R. Blatchley Iii, W. Travis Horton, David M. Warsinger Jan 2021

Photocatalytic Inactivation Efficacy Of Sars-Cov-2 In Hvac Systems, Andrew J. Freeman, Sudharshan Anandan, Ernest R. Blatchley Iii, W. Travis Horton, David M. Warsinger

Discovery Undergraduate Interdisciplinary Research Internship

The coronavirus pandemic has emphasized a need for robust and reliable air purification systems in buildings; with that comes a need for a standardized testing methodology for air purification technologies in HVAC air circulation systems. One such method of air purification is photocatalytic oxidation (PCO), a mechanism in which a catalyst irradiated by light produces reactive molecules that degrade a wide range of pollutants, including the aerosols that carry COVID. This technology has primarily been used in aqueous applications, but there have recently been developments in air purification that have made it a promising contender to existing technologies. Fabrication And Imaging Characterization Of Poly (Dimethyl Siloxane)/Sic Nano-Fillers Samples As Model Biomaterials, Tetiana Soloviova, Viorica Gutu, Zoya Vinokur, Akm S. Rahman, Subhendra Sarkar Dec 2019

Fabrication And Imaging Characterization Of Poly (Dimethyl Siloxane)/Sic Nano-Fillers Samples As Model Biomaterials, Tetiana Soloviova, Viorica Gutu, Zoya Vinokur, Akm S. Rahman, Subhendra Sarkar

Publications and Research

Biopolymers are being developed with embedded nanostructures for in vivo drug delivery to treat various diseases including cancers. In the current project we developed fabrication steps to prepare two biopolymers, poly di-methoxy siloxane (PDMS) with 0-0.9 vol% of SiC nano whisker (fillers) followed by non- destructive characterization. Optical reflection microscopy (5-100X) was performed to ensure loading and distribution of increasing SiC content. Optical microscopy showed progressively higher SiC distribution as filler loading was increased from 0-0.9 vol%.
